Hugh Williamson: What’s at stake for OSCE in Ukraine and beyond?
The Ukraine crisis has focussed attention on the Organisation for Security and Co-operation in Europe in Germany and elsewhere. Foreign Minister Frank-Walter Steinmeier has consistently pushed for a stronger role for the OSCE in Ukraine and defended it against criticism in Berlin following the release of the kidnapped OSCE military observers in early May.
